Typical Day
- Working with a drivers mate to deliver home furnishings and white goods to Argos customers' homes.
- Multiple drop home deliveries β 30 to 45 drops per day.
- Manual handling is required with your mate, with new equipment available to support.
- Installation of some products complete with full training.
Requirements
- Drive in a safe and efficient manner, ensuring adherence to parking, speed and road signage.
- Work safely within the Health and Safety Environmental Guidelines and ensure all vehicle checks are carried out prior to commencement of work.
- Be flexible in approach to work and work effectively as part of a team, providing support in resolving problems.
- Have a can-do, right-first-time and passionate approach.
- Work within all legal parameters of driver's hours and working time directive legislation, being fully compliant with tachograph and break requirements.
- No experience necessary OR experienced drivers with a driver CPC qualification, Drivers Qualification Card (DQC) and valid Digital Tachograph card.
